Total Spectrum is looking for a bachelor's-level ABA professional to join us in providing high-quality, evidence-based, contemporary ABA therapy to children with autism. Board Certified Assistant Behavior Analysts (BCaBAs) have demonstrated expertise in behavior treatment and are committed to delivering individualized, person-centered care rooted in the principles of assent-based treatment. BCaBAs assist behavior analysts in supervising cases, providing protocol modification, delivering treatment by protocol, and family treatment guidance. Allow Us toIntroduce Ourselves:

Bachelor's degree required Board Certified Assistant Behavior Analyst (BCaBA) or expected to sit for the BCaBA exam in the next three months Supervision hours in progress or completed (as outlined by the BACB requirements) Certification, registration, and/or license as required by local statutes to deliver behavior treatment Commitment to our five values: clinical curiosity, integrity, parent partnership, client-focus, and clinical competencyWhat You'll Be Doing:
Provide behavior treatment by protocol to clients, as-needed Provide clinical direction to technicians, as-needed Assist behavior analysts in protocol modification, assessments, family treatment guidance, treatment planning and clinical programming Follow guidelines regarding time spent on non-billable activities Ensure data is collected and recorded with fidelity and reliability Complete mandatory trainings and attend required meetings Document services delivered accurately and timely according to company policies Report clinical and scheduling concerns promptly Adhere to all company compliance policies, written or unwritten Complete other tasks as assigned by supervisor Total Spectrum/LEARN Behavioral is an Equal Opportunity Employer.
